Grammar

Feel stress or feel stressed

I'm not sure if it is better to say

I feel / have a lot of stress every day

Or

I feel stressed every day

Is there a difference?
Thanks
Jay
  

Top answer

Normally you feel the stress of something and you are stressed or feel stressed. I feel the stress of daily life. I've been really stressed lately.

  • Normally you feel the stress of something and you are stressed or feel stressed.
  • I feel the stress of daily life.
  • I've been really stressed lately.
  • In AmE, "stressed out" is also common.
  • I've been really stressed out lately.
